IQV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review

849 of the 5,745 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in IQVIA (IQV)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$40.9B — up 26% from $32.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 127 funds opened new IQV positions and 47 closed out — a net gain of 80 holders — while 319 added to existing stakes and 281 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Ameriprise, adding an estimated $226M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, cutting an estimated $285M.
